Motivating Effects of Negative-hedonic Valence Encoded in Engrams.

Abstract

Engrams are neuronal alterations that encode associations between environmental contexts and subjectively rewarding or aversive experiences within sparsely activated neuronal assemblies that regulate behavioral responses. How positive- or negative-hedonic states are represented in brain neurocircuits is a fundamental question relevant for understanding the processing of emotionally meaningful stimuli that drive appropriate or maladaptive behavior, respectively. It is well-known that animals avoid noxious stimuli and experiences. Little is known, however, how the conditioning of environmental or contextual stimuli to behavior that leads to amelioration of dysphoric states establishes powerful associations leading to compulsive maladaptive behavior. Here we have studied engrams that encode the conditioned effects of alcohol-related stimuli associated with the reversal of the dysphoric withdrawal state in alcohol dependent rats and document the recruitment of engrams in the paraventricular nucleus of the thalamus (PVT), the central nucleus of the amygdala (CeA), and the Dorsal Striatum (DS). The findings suggest that the encoding of associations between reversal of negative hedonic states and environmental contexts in these engrams may serve as a neural mechanism for compulsive alcohol seeking and vulnerability to relapse associated with dysregulation of reward to a pathological allostatic level.

摘要

记忆印迹是神经元的改变,它在调节行为反应的稀疏激活的神经元集合中编码环境背景与主观奖励或厌恶体验之间的关联。大脑神经回路如何表征积极或消极的享乐状态是一个基本问题,这对于理解分别驱动适当或适应不良行为的情感意义刺激的处理至关重要。众所周知,动物会避免有害刺激和体验。然而,鲜为人知的是,将环境或情境刺激与导致烦躁状态改善的行为进行条件反射如何建立强大的关联,从而导致强迫性适应不良行为。在这里,我们研究了编码与酒精依赖大鼠烦躁戒断状态逆转相关的酒精相关刺激的条件作用的记忆印迹,并记录了丘脑室旁核(PVT)、杏仁核中央核(CeA)和背侧纹状体(DS)中记忆印迹的募集。研究结果表明,这些记忆印迹中负性享乐状态逆转与环境背景之间关联的编码可能作为一种神经机制,导致强迫性觅酒以及与奖励失调至病理性稳态水平相关的复发易感性。
